About Gonzalez City/School Park in Mcallen

Gonzalez Park, located in McAllen, Texas, is a community park that offers various recreational facilities for residents and visitors. The park spans 24.6 acres, providing ample space for outdoor activities and relaxation.

Situated in one of the city's most vibrant areas, Gonzalez Park is known locally as "G park" and is considered a gem by many in the community. The park features tall, expansive trees that provide shade and natural beauty to the landscape.

Gonzalez Park is conveniently located within walking distance of several local amenities, including Castaneda Elementary, Faulk Middle School, HEB grocery store, Southmost Trail, and the Border Fence.

One of the park's unique features is a recreation center that incorporates a graffiti art wall. This wall showcases artwork celebrating aspects of the Brownsville community, creating a vibrant and culturally significant park icon.

The park is a hub of activity, regularly hosting soccer matches, various league games, community events, after-school programs for children, and Zumba classes for the general public. Additionally, a small parade passes through Gonzalez Park every year, adding to its community significance.
